The Process of Buying a German GmbH
Acquiring a German GmbH involves several steps‚ which can be complex and time-consuming. Here’s an overview of the process:
- Company Search: Find a suitable GmbH for sale in Germany.
- Due Diligence: Review the company’s financials‚ contracts‚ and other relevant documents.
- Negotiation: Agree on the purchase price and terms with the seller.
- Notary Support: Engage a German notary to facilitate the transfer of shares.
- Registration: Register the new ownership with the commercial register.
The Role of a Notary in Germany
In Germany‚ a notary plays a crucial role in the sale and purchase of a GmbH. The notary ensures that the transaction is carried out in accordance with German law. Here’s what you can expect from a notary:
- Verification: The notary verifies the identity of the parties involved.
- Drafting: The notary drafts the share purchase agreement.
- Execution: The notary witnesses the signing of the agreement.
- Registration: The notary facilitates the registration of the new ownership.

Additional Costs and Considerations
In addition to the purchase price‚ consider the following costs and factors:
- Notary Fees: Notary fees can range from 0.2% to 1.5% of the purchase price.
- Registration Fees: Registration fees with the commercial register can range from €100 to €500.
- Tax Implications: Consider the tax implications of the acquisition‚ including any potential tax liabilities.
- Employment Law: If the GmbH has employees‚ consider the implications of employment law in Germany.
